Redis让性能优化更轻松(性能优化用redis)
Redis,全称为Remote Dictionary Server,是一个开源的高性能Nosql库,由Salvatore Sanfilippo和Pieter Noordhuis在2009年发布,利用Redis可以轻松部署高性能的分布式存储系统。
Redis的性能优势体现在数据实时处理方面,由于它支持多种数据类型,并且可以与其他数据库相结合,因此具有非常强大的性能优势,其中包括低延迟,高吞吐率,持久化操作等特点,使其能够快速与大量数据建立连接,完成数据存储,读写,计算等操作。
一般来说,使用Redis性能优化的步骤如下:
1、安装Redis:下载redis-server,安装后访问redis-cli命令行工具,完成Redis的配置;
2、连接Redis:使用任何一种编程语言,通过Redis协议建立与Redis服务器的连接;
3、优化数据存储:利用其自带的缓存、数据类型以及特殊的数据结构来优化数据的存储;
4、性能优化:可以通过调整Redis的参数,或者使用Redis的分布式框架,比如Sentinel,实现Redis集群,来提升Redis应用的响应速度;
5、检查性能:通过Redis的数据指标(如内存消耗、I/O时延等)来检查Redis的性能,及时对Redis的性能优化进行改进。
以上就是使用Redis来实现性能优化的基本步骤,由于Redis具有强大的性能优势,所以被广泛应用于在线实时数据处理,可以让企业轻松实现性能优化。